Common Types and Causes of Car Accidents in Dallas

Texas roads see a high volume of traffic, and unfortunately, car accidents are frequent. Understanding the common types and causes of accidents can shed light on the factors that may be relevant to your claim.

Common types of car accidents include:

  • Rear-End Collisions: Often caused by distracted driving or following too closely.
  • Head-On Collisions: Frequently result in severe injuries and can be caused by drunk driving or wrong-way driving.
  • Side-Impact Collisions (T-Bone Accidents): Common at intersections, often due to failure to yield or running red lights.
  • Single-Vehicle Accidents: Can involve rollovers, collisions with objects, and may be caused by driver error, road hazards, or vehicle defects.
  • Multi-Vehicle Accidents: Complex situations involving multiple parties and insurance policies, often occurring on highways or during inclement weather.

Leading causes of car accidents in Dallas include:

  • Distracted Driving: Texting, phone calls, eating, or other distractions behind the wheel.
  • Speeding: Exceeding posted speed limits or driving too fast for conditions.
  • Drunk Driving (DWI/DUI): Driving under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
  • Reckless Driving: Aggressive behaviors like weaving, tailgating, and ignoring traffic laws.
  • Driver Fatigue: Driving while tired can impair reaction time and judgment.
  • Failure to Yield: Not yielding the right-of-way to other vehicles or pedestrians.

Most car accidents stem from driver negligence, meaning a driver failed to exercise reasonable care while operating their vehicle, leading to a crash and injuries. This negligence is the basis for most car accident claims.

Steps to Take After a Car Accident in Dallas

Your actions immediately following a car accident can significantly impact your ability to pursue a successful injury claim. While your priority is safety and medical attention, taking the following steps can protect your rights:

  1. Ensure Safety and Call 911: Check for injuries and move to a safe location if possible. Call 911 to report the accident and request police and ambulance if needed.
  2. Seek Medical Attention: Even if you don’t feel immediately injured, seek medical evaluation as soon as possible. Some injuries, like whiplash or concussions, may not be immediately apparent. Prompt medical care is crucial for your health and your claim.
  3. Gather Information at the Scene (If Possible):
    • Exchange information with the other driver(s): names, contact information, insurance details, and license plate numbers.
    • Collect witness information: names and contact details of anyone who saw the accident.
    • Take photos of the accident scene: vehicle damage, injuries, road conditions, traffic signs, and overall scene.
  4. Obtain the Police Report: Get the crash report number from the responding officer. This report is a crucial piece of evidence in your claim.
  5. Avoid Admitting Fault: Do not apologize or admit fault at the scene, as this can be used against you later. Stick to factual statements when speaking with the police and other driver.

Dealing with Insurance Companies After a Dallas Car Accident

Navigating insurance claims can be complex and frustrating. Remember that insurance companies are businesses, and their goal is to minimize payouts. Dealing with them directly, especially when injured, can put you at a disadvantage.

Common insurance company tactics to watch out for:

  • Low Initial Offers: Quick settlement offers that are far below the actual value of your claim.
  • Delay Tactics: Prolonging the claims process to frustrate you and pressure you into accepting a lower settlement.
  • Disputing Liability: Attempting to shift blame to you or minimize the other driver’s fault.
  • Minimizing Injuries: Downplaying the severity of your injuries or claiming they are not accident-related.
  • Requesting Recorded Statements: Using your words against you to weaken your claim.
  • Bad Faith Practices: Unfair or deceptive tactics used to avoid paying a legitimate claim.

Time Limits: The Statute of Limitations in Texas Car Accident Cases

In Texas, there is a stat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including car accidents. This sets a deadline for filing a lawsuit. In most Texas car accident cases, you have two (2) years from the date of the accident to file a lawsuit.

Missing this deadline means you lose your legal right to pursue compensation. While two years may seem like a long time, it’s crucial to act quickly. Gathering evidence, investigating the accident, and negotiating with insurance companies takes time. Common Injuries in Car Accidents

Car accidents can cause a wide range of injuries, from minor to severe. Some common injuries include:

  • Whiplash: Neck injuries caused by sudden back-and-forth movement.
  • Back Injuries: Sprains, strains, herniated discs, and spinal cord injuries.
  • Head Injuries: Concussions, traumatic brain injuries (TBIs), and skull fractures.
  • Broken Bones: Fractures of arms, legs, ribs, and other bones.
  • Soft Tissue Injuries: Bruises, sprains, strains, and tears to muscles, ligaments, and tendons.
  • Cuts and Lacerations: From broken glass or debris.
  • Internal Injuries: Damage to organs, which may not be immediately apparent.
  • Psychological Trauma: Emotional distress, anxiety, PTSD.

Even seemingly minor injuries should be taken seriously. Delaying medical treatment can worsen your condition and complicate your legal claim. Document all injuries and medical treatment as part of your car accident case.

Understanding the Value of Your Dallas Car Accident Case

Determining the value of a car accident case is complex and depends on various factors, including:

  • Severity of Injuries: The type and extent of your injuries significantly impact case value. More severe injuries typically result in higher compensation.
  • Medical Expenses: Past, present, and future medical costs are a key component of damages.
  • Lost Income: Wages lost due to the accident, including future earning capacity if injuries prevent you from returning to work.
  • Property Damage: Costs to repair or replace your vehicle and other damaged property.
  • Pain and Suffering: Compensation for physical pain, emotional distress, and reduced quality of life.
  • Liability: The degree of fault assigned to each driver.
  • Insurance Coverage: Policy limits of the at-fault driver’s insurance.

Settlement vs. Trial in Car Accident Cases

Most car accident cases are resolved through settlement negotiations out of court. This involves reaching an agreement with the insurance company on a fair amount of compensation. Settlement is often faster and less expensive than going to trial.

However, if a fair settlement cannot be reached, your Dallas car accident lawyer will be prepared to file a lawsuit and take your case to trial. Trial involves presenting your case to a judge or jury who will decide the outcome. While less common, going to trial may be necessary to obtain the full compensation you deserve.
